Photino

Photino is a lightweight open-source framework for building native, cross-platform desktop applications with Web UI technology.

Photino 4 features
ReactNativeEverywhere 5 features
  • Lightweight
    Photino is designed to be a lightweight alternative to Electron and similar technologies, which means it can use fewer resources and provide faster startup times.
  • Cross-platform
    Photino allows developers to create applications that run on Windows, macOS, and Linux using a single codebase.
  • Open Source
    Photino is open-source, allowing developers to modify and adapt the source code to better suit their needs.
  • .NET and HTML/CSS/JavaScript Support
    Photino supports developing applications using .NET technologies along with standard web technologies, making it accessible to a wide range of developers.

Possible disadvantages

  • Limited Ecosystem
    As a relatively new project, Photino may have a smaller community and fewer resources available compared to more established frameworks like Electron.
  • Maturity
    Being a newer technology, Photino might encounter stability issues and evolving features, which could be a concern for long-term projects.
  • Third-Party Integration
    Photino might have less support for third-party libraries and integrations compared to more widely adopted platforms.
  • Complexity for Certain Apps
    While it offers simplicity for many applications, more complex and performance-intensive apps might require the advanced capabilities of heavier frameworks.
  • Cross-Platform Development
    ReactNativeEverywhere allows developers to use a single codebase to build applications for multiple platforms (iOS, Android, Web, and Desktop), reducing development time and effort.
  • Strong Community Support
    Being based on React and React Native, ReactNativeEverywhere benefits from a large community of developers who contribute to its ecosystem with libraries, tools, and resources.
  • Reusable Components
    Developers can use and share components across different platforms, promoting consistency and reducing redundant work.
  • Knowledge Reusability
    Developers familiar with React can easily transition to using ReactNativeEverywhere without the need to learn new programming languages or frameworks.
  • Rich Ecosystem
    ReactNativeEverywhere is supported by a vast array of plugins and third-party libraries that can significantly streamline development.

Possible disadvantages

  • Performance Overhead
    While it provides a convenient way to build cross-platform applications, ReactNativeEverywhere might not match the performance of native applications, especially for resource-intensive tasks.
  • Limited Native Features Access
    Certain platform-specific features might not be fully supported or require additional native modules, which can complicate development.
  • Ecosystem Fragmentation
    Since ReactNativeEverywhere relies on various third-party libraries, inconsistencies and fragmentation in library support across different platforms can emerge.
  • Learning Curve for Native Modules
    Developers may need to understand native development if they plan to build custom modules or face platform-specific issues.
  • UI Consistency Challenges
    Achieving a consistent user interface across all platforms can be challenging due to the differing design guidelines and components for each platform.
